About D.G. MacDonald

D.G. MacDonald is a scholar working on Oral Surgery, Surgery, Oncology, Otorhinolaryngology and Periodontics, having authored 107 papers that have together received 3.3k ind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Oral and Maxillofacial Pathology (29 papers), Head and Neck Cancer Studies (19 papers), Salivary Gland Tumors Diagnosis and Treatment (18 papers), Ear and Head Tumors (13 papers), Oral Health Pathology and Treatment (12 papers), Tumors and Oncological Cases (8 papers), Cancer Diagnosis and Treatment (6 papers) and dental development and anomalies (6 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Otorhinolaryngology (1.1k citations), Periodontics (582 citations), Oral Surgery (707 citations), Microbiology (55 citations) and Oncology (1.0k citations). D.G. MacDonald has collaborated with scholars based in United Kingdom, Canada and United States. Frequent co-authors include David S. Soutar, Taimur Shoaib, J.S. Rennie, Gary Ross, I. Camilleri, H. W. Gray, Ian A. McGregor, M.M. Ferguson, R. G. Bessent and J.W. Eveson. Their work appears in journals such as Journal of Oral Pathology and Medicine, Archives of Oral Biology, Journal of Dentistry, British Journal of Oral and Maxillofacial Surgery and BDJ.
